Phoenix-Mesa Gateway Airport is offering flights
to smaller towns across the US.
As more people visit Arizona, or choose to move here for the winter months purchasing a home in the Mesa, Arizona area, more and more flights are being added to Allegiant Air’s schedule.
Always keep in mind that airline flight schedules are subject to change without notice via their web site. Please contact the airline directly to confirm arrival and departure times and to make reservations.
Please check-in a minimum of two hours prior to your scheduled departure time or check with the Airline to confirm minimum check-in time.
